About This Item
IEC 62805-2:2017 defines a technical method for measuring photovoltaic (PV) glass, with specific attention to transmittance and reflectance. For engineering teams, laboratories, and procurement specialists, it provides a focused reference for comparing optical performance data in a structured way.
